42
12
52
78
334
19
29
88
40
105
43
314
218
112
126
81
111
604
9
358
324
68
23
108
133
277
15
583
92
64
53
178
148
383
376
272
374
91
103
270
80
161
41
121
362
120
2
94
55
66
67
251
296